Rocscience RocTopple – Toppling Stability Analysis for Slopes
Block Toppling Model
Analyze 2D block or block-flexural toppling stability given the slope geometry, and the joint spacing, dip and strength. RocTopple employs the Block toppling method of Goodman and Bray (1976), a Limit Equilibrium method which takes into account toppling and sliding failure modes of each individual block.
Deterministic or Probabilistic Analysis
Calculate a factor of safety with deterministic analysis or the probability of failure for probabilistic models. You can model variability in geometry, point of force application, joint and bedding strength, water pressure, external loads, and supports by assigning statistical distributions to variables. Create histogram, cumulative, and scatter plots of statistical data.
Support & Loading
Implement bolts to anchor potentially unstable blocks. Apply external loads to your models in the form of line loads, distributed loads, seismic loads and water pressure.
Export your slope and block geometry from RocTopple as a DXF file and import it into RS2 for advanced analysis using Finite Element Method.
